				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I say the last update because I am tired of posting falsely, well I can only post what I find on the net so maybe its not false, just the worst launch of a product ever, and the most sought after Android Tablet to date&#8230; My update is this. The Transformer Prime has shipped to some customers, I am not one of them, if you pre-ordered around the end of November, do not expect to see it till January, most likely mid-January. For the time being you can browse the download page for the Transformer Prime, Asus finally launched it. There are some firmware updates, USB Drivers for Windows, Utilities to pair and sync contacts, (if you aren&#8217;t using Active Sync), also the source code for the Eee Pad Kernel, and  finally, Eee Pad PC Suite. Go <a href="http://www.asus.com/Eee/Eee_Pad/Eee_Pad_Transformer_Prime_TF201/#download" target="_blank">here</a> for the downloads.</p>
<p>So go ahead, pre-download the software, then wait patiently for Asus to start shipping you your Asus Transformer Prime(if that is what it will be called, Hasbro is demanding that Asus drop the name Transformer Prime, why didn&#8217;t they act earlier?)</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>What is being dubbed the best tablet on the market today (well it&#8217;s not quite here yet) is almost ready to be released to the masses. Some stores even have demo units of the Transformer Prime. What I hear is that it will be release December 19th, but some say December 8th or 12th, so I am not too sure what to believe. geek.com states a US release date of December 19th, so I will have to go with that. I already pre-ordered two of them, so lets hope it makes it in time for my trip to Las Vegas on the 25th! I can give you a nice little review in January. Here are the specs. Note that it is a Quad Core CPU, but has a 5th core to deal with mundane background tasks, I believe this is how it can get 12 hours of battery life while having a 1.4Ghz Quad core powerhouse processor.</p>

<p>**UPDATE** Dec 7th 2011</p>
<p>It Doesnt look like the Transformer Prime will hit stores on the 15th like they wanted. Apparently and I have seen this at 2 sources already, the WIFI on model TF201 didn&#8217;t meet Asus&#8217; quality standards and they are working on a solution. This can&#8217;t be good. I know Apple put their WIFI antenna behind the plastic &#8220;Apple&#8221; logo to boost their WIFI signals&#8230; What is Asus going to do?</p>
